New York to Require Warning Labels on Social Media Platforms

Illustration by Spencer Platt/Getty ImagesNew York is requiring warning labels on platforms’ addictive features in a bid to address a youth mental health crisis tied to social media.Gov. Kathy Hochul signed the bill into law on Dec. 26, targeting infinite scrolling, auto-play videos, and algorithmic feeds that encourage prolonged use.
